Job Title: Virtual HIL Commissioning Engineer
Location: Auburn Hills, Michigan
 
What you’ll be doing:
The Virtual Test Engineer is responsible for delivering a stable and representative test environment to
perform automated testing and functional integration of distributed features. This engineer should be
capable of working with various Engineering Support teams including systems, wiring, design release
engineers, and software teams as required to validate electrical features on the bench and resolve any
electrical issues before it gets to production to support successful vehicle launch. Responsibilities
include:
 Identify system boundaries and define requirements for simulator I/O, instrumentation, and
automation solutions
 Define test scope and instrumentation strategies
 Model, Simulate powertrain features
 Help with commissioning of features related to transmission, engine and other powertrain
module
 Collaborates with core engineers, suppliers, feature experts and test engineers to design,
implement and troubleshoot instrumentation as required
 Review component level electrical schematics and functional specifications and translate the
requirements into hardware and signal requirements for virtual implementation
 Validate and troubleshoots simulator and maintain test benches
 Troubleshoots vehicle systems and test environment functionality to minimize false positive
incident reports
 
What you need for this position:
Basic Qualifications:
 Bachelor of Science in Electrical, Computer Engineering or Computer Science
 Relevant automotive experience
 Knowledge of CAN based communication and diagnostic tools – Vector CANalyzer/CANoe
 Proficient with Modeling
 Good knowledge and understanding of DSpace Tools – config desk, automation desk,
control desk etc..
 Proficiency in the understanding of embedded controller networks (CAN, LIN)
Preferred Qualifications: 
 Familiarity with development and verification of plant and control models in
Matlab/Simulink for execution in hardware in the loop test environments
 Experience with dSpace hardware architecture, design, setup, and troubleshooting
 Bench functional integration, test execution, measuring and instrumentation
